Kalshiolin A, new lignan from Kalimeris shimadai.

Guo-Kai Wang1,2, Wen-Fang Jin1, Nan Zhang1, Gang Wang1, Yung-Yi Cheng2,3, Susan L Morris-Natschke2, Masuo Goto2, Zhong-Yu Zhou4, Jin-Song Liu1, Kuo-Hsiung Lee2,3.   

Abstract

The Asian plant Kalimeris shimadai has been used as food and ethnologic medicine for over a thousand years. In this study, we isolated and identified one new lignan, kalshiolin A (1), and 12 known lignans (2-13). The structures were characterized by the comprehensive analyses of spectroscopic data (HR-ESI-MS, IR, 1D, and 2D-NMR) and the absolute configuration of 1 was determined from ECD calculations. The new compound 1 was also screened for cytotoxic activity but did not show significant potency (IC50 35.9-43.3 μM) against A549, MDA-MB-231, MCF7, KB, and KB-VIN cell lines.
